Thai Beef With Noodles
Cut: Top Sirloin Steak
Preparation Time: 5 Minutes
Marinate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es |
|

|
Main Ingredients:
1 lb. boneless beef top sirloin, cut 1-inch thick
1/4 c. dry sherry
1 1/2 TBS. reduced-sodium soy sauce
1 tsp. fresh ginger, grated
1 tsp. garlic, minced
1 tsp. Oriental dark roasted sesame oil
1/4 to 1/2 tsp. red pepper pods, crushed
2 c. cooked Ramen noodles or linguine
1/4 c. green onion tops or fresh cilantro, chopped
Directions:
- Combine sherry, soy sauce, ginger, garlic, sesame oil and pepper pods for marinade. Place beef steak in plastic bag; add marinade. Close bag securely and marinate 15 minutes. Pour off marinade. Bring marinade to a rolling boil; reserve.
- Heat nonstick skillet over medium heat for 5 minutes. Add steak and cook 12 to 15 minutes for rare (140 degrees) to medium (160 degrees), turning once. Remove steak; keep warm. Dissolve 2 tsp. cornstarch in reserved marinade and 1/4 c. water; add to skillet.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ly. Stir in noodles. Carve steak into thin slices and serve over noodles. Sprinkle with green onion. Makes 4 servings.
Recipe Tips:
- A small beef tenderloin could be substituted for top sirloin.
- If fresh ginger is not available, use a teaspoon of ground ginger.
- This recipe can be easily adjusted for 2 servings. Go ahead and make the same amount of sauce, just use less beef.
Recipe Notes:
Nutrition Information per serving: 305 calories; 31 g protein; 23 g carbohydrate; 7 g fat; 4.7 mg iron; 302 mg sodium; 78 mg cholesterol.
